Where are Lexus RC built?
The Lexus RC, a luxury sports coupe, is primarily manufactured at the Motomachi Plant in Toyota City, Aichi Prefecture, Japan. This state-of-the-art facility is one of Lexus' key production sites, responsible for assembling various Lexus models, including the RC.

Lexus RC Model Variants
The Lexus RC is available in several model variants, each catering to different customer preferences and driving experiences:
- Lexus RC 300: Powered by a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ine, delivering 241 horsepower.
- Lexus RC 350: Features a 3.5-liter V6 engine, producing 311 horsepower.
- Lexus RC F: The high-performance variant, equipped with a 5.0-liter V8 engine that generates 472 horsepower.
Regardless of the model variant, all Lexus RC vehicles are meticulously assembled at the Motomachi Plant, ensuring a consistent level of quality and attention to detail.
